The Importance of Proper Sewage Cleanup & Disinfection Process in Greenville, TX

A proper sewage cleanup and disinfection process is crucial to prevent further damage, health risks, and costly repairs. Our team follows a meticulous process to ensure a thorough cleanup, disinfection, and restoration of your property. We understand that cutting corners can lead to bigger problems down the line, so we take the time to do it right. Our process includes:

Step 1: Inspection and Assessment

Our technicians conduct a thorough inspection to identify the source of the sewage backup and assess the extent of the damage. We use specialized equipment to detect hidden water and ensure a complete cleanup. This step typically takes 30 minutes to an hour, depending on the size of the affected area.

Step 2: Water Removal and Extraction

We use advanced equipment to remove up to 2 inches of standing water, reducing damage and ensuring a thorough cleanup. Our technicians work efficiently to extract as much water as possible, using specialized vacuums and pumps to speed up the process. This step typically takes 1-2 hours, depending on the size of the affected area.

Step 3: Disinfection and Sanitizing

Next, we disinfect and sanitize the affected area to prevent the growth of bacteria, mold, and mildew. Our technicians use EPA-registered disinfectants and sanitizers to ensure a safe and healthy environment. This step typically takes 30 minutes to an hour, depending on the size of the affected area.

Step 4: Drying and Dehumidification

We use specialized equipment to dry and dehumidify the affected area, preventing secondary damage and ensuring a thorough restoration. Our technicians monitor the environment to ensure a safe and healthy environment. This step typically takes 3-5 days, depending on the size of the affected area and local conditions.

Step 5: Cleanup and Restoration

Finally, we thoroughly clean and restore the affected area to its former glory. Our technicians work efficiently to remove any remaining debris, clean and disinfect surfaces, and restore damaged materials. This step typically takes 1-3 days, depending on the size of the affected area and the extent of the damage.

Sewage Cleanup & Disinfection Cost in Greenville, TX

The cost of sewage cleanup and disinfection in Greenville, TX, can vary depending on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our prices typically range from $500 to $2,500, depending on the extent of the damage. Keep in mind that these estimates are based on a typical sewage backup and may vary depending on your specific situation.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Removal and Extraction $500 – $2,000 The size of the affected area and the amount of water removed
Disinfection and Sanitizing $100 – $500 The size of the affected area and the type of disinfectant used
Drying and Dehumidification $500 – $2,000 The size of the affected area and the length of time required for drying and dehumidification
